67 front drums not budging

We’ve all banged on drums to get loose but I have to tell you the front drums on my 67 c10 will not break loose. The truck has been sitting 10 plus years. The rears took a few hits but came off ok. Just not sure why the fronts are so tough.

The drums rotate fine on both front sides. There is a large spring that is wrapped around the drum. Does that need to come off? Is there something else holding it on? I’ve hit it with Kroil, wd40! And even heat and no budge.

Any tricks out there ?

I’m using a good old school wire brush and a sludge hammer.
